What are the responsibilities and job description for the Aerie Restaurant Bar Supervisor (FT) position at Grand Traverse Resort and Spa?
SUMMARY
Assist in supplying total guest satisfaction through prompt, courteous and professional service, while maintaining a highly motivated and well-trained staff. Maintain high quality standards in regards to drink production and presentation, and sanitation and safety. To provide supervision of restaurant staff in the absence of Assistant Manager and/or Restaurant Manager. To continually strive for 100% guest satisfaction within assigned restaurant outlet by providing and ensuring a consistent quality of service through prudent supervision of the bar and lounge.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
To foster an environment conducive to guest satisfaction through prudent supervision and training of staff
Assist in the training and coaching of all bartenders
Encourage and motivate staff to maintain a high level of morale at all times
Practice and promote safe alcohol management
Keep accurate wine bottle counts in Micros
Ensure appropriate par levels of chilled white wines
Keep the bar and surrounding areas neat and clean
Support upper management decision and assist staff where needed- in any position
Collaboration with the manager on cocktail creations and beverage selections, to include elevated garnishes
Ensuring all glassware and utensils are polished before use
Ensure we will be stocked up on non-traditional ice cubes for the following evenings service
Follow all state laws regarding intoxicated patrons
Promote and practice professional and consistent standards of service and cleanliness to all employees
Bartenders must be sure guests meet age requirements for the purchase of alcohol. Check identification and make sure our customers are not over-consuming
Collects payment from guests accurately. Handle cash accurately and give correct change. Records all transactions in the Micros system.
Monitor the use and handling of facility resources, including linens, equipment and paper products
Monitor guest satisfaction and feedback on a daily basis
Follow all prescribed sanitation laws issued by county health department
Ensure beverage service is prompt and efficient while following all local and state laws regarding beverage product and service
Ensure quality food and beverage standards are met
Assume all responsibilities delegated by the manager and do any or all other duties to fulfill customer needs and requests
Keep waste and spoilage to a minimum by proper rotation, storage, and usage of all food items
Attend all meetings and complete all online training sessions
Assist in ordering of supplies and keeping adequate par up levels
Perform opening and closing procedures of the restaurant to include that the nightly tip out sheet is properly filled out
Maintain open line of communication and act as a link between the Manager and Staff
Must follow proper grooming and dress standards set forth by the Employee Handbook
Must understand and abide by environmental practices of the Grand Traverse Resort and Spa
Other duties as assigned
